What issues did the Parliamentary panel raise regarding the User Development Fee charged by airports
A Parliamentary panel has raised questions on the 'arbitrary' User Development Fee charged by airports.
- The Parliamentary panel questioned the arbitrariness of the User Development Fee charged by airports in India.
- They raised concerns about the lack of transparency in the determination and collection of the User Development Fee.
- The panel highlighted instances where passengers were reportedly charged exorbitant fees without proper justification.
- They recommended the need for a comprehensive review of the fee structure to ensure it is fair and reasonable for passengers.
- The panel suggested that regulatory authorities should monitor and regulate the imposition of the User Development Fee to prevent abuse and exploitation.
